Shortly after Tron's Comic-Con panel, moderator Patton Oswalt introduced a teaser trailer for Disney's Haunted Mansion and its director writer/producer Guillermo Del Toro. I guess we know why he can't do the Hobbit. WTF?!

"Dark imagery is an integral part of the Walt Disney legacy. After all, Disney himself was the father of some really chilling moments and characters - think Chernabog from Fantasia or Maleficent as the Dragon or the Evil Queen in Snow White," said del Toro. "I couldn't be more excited to be a part of my own adaptation of the original theme park attraction Walt envisioned and that remains- for me- the most desirable piece of real estate in the whole world!"

  1. Haunted Mansion is about my favorite ride at Magic Kingdom, but it simply won't work as a movie. The whole point is to be fully immersed in this creepy imagery constantly wondering how they did it because you can actually see it without a camera and a projector in between you. It doesn't need a story other than those implied by the vignettes you go through, but it does need to be real, right there in front of you. The largest Pepper's Ghost illusion in the world is awesome. Another 3D effect on a screen is not.
